WASHINGTON - Washingtoner -- The American Conference Institute (ACI) will host the National Congress on Next Generation Military and Veterans Healthcare Systems this March 14-16, 2023, in Washington, DC.
Co-chaired by the honorable Dr. David Shulkin, Ninth Secretary, U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s, and COL (USA-Ret) Ron Poropatich, MD, University of Pittsburgh-- the conference will bring together Military, Government, health care providers, academia, and consultants to explore opportunities to improve healthcare access and delivery to our nation's veterans.

Co-chaired by the honorable Dr. David Shulkin, Ninth Secretary, U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s, and COL (USA-Ret) Ron Poropatich, MD, University of Pittsburgh-- the conference will bring together Military, Government, health care providers, academia, and consultants to explore opportunities to improve healthcare access and delivery to our nation's veterans.
Presenters include Dr. Brian C. Lein, Assistant Director, Healthcare Administration, Defense Health Agency, Matthew Quinn, Science Director, Army Telehealth & Advanced Technology Research Center (TATRC), Daniel Abrahamson, MoPOC, National Program Manage , Department of Veterans Affairs among others that will also present at this critical and timely event.
Topics to be discussed include:
- Advancements in VA Prosthetics Technology and Treatments
- Leveraging Mixed Reality Technology to Enhance VA Surgical Care
- Forecasting the Future of AI in Healthcare: Key Considerations for use in Oncology and Mental Health
- Mobile and Telehealth: What's next in monitoring, and information sharing for combat casualty care and VA patient populations
In addition to the congress, ACI will host a special Think Tank on VA Women's Health System Modernization on March 16. This one-day leadership summit is a series of curated discussions aimed at identifying and addressing current and future care needs of women service members.
